Are online casinos legal in China?

Online gambling is illegal in mainland China, and the government maintains strict controls over gambling activities. However, many Chinese players access offshore online casinos which are regulated and licensed in other jurisdictions, operating in a legal grey area from the perspective of mainland China.

What payment methods are popular for Chinese players?

While direct bank transfers to offshore casinos can be challenging, Chinese players often use cryptocurrencies (like USDT and Bitcoin), international e-wallets, or various intermediary payment services that facilitate cross-border transactions. Some sites might also offer card options that process international payments.

Can I play in Chinese Yuan (CNY) at new online casinos?

While many new online casinos display balances and bonuses in CNY for player convenience, actual transactions are often processed in major international currencies like USD or EUR, with automatic currency conversion applying to deposits and withdrawals.

What types of games are most favored by Chinese players?

Baccarat is overwhelmingly popular among Chinese players. Other favored game types include Sic Bo, Dragon Tiger, Mahjong-themed slot machines, fishing games, and crash games (such as Aviator).

How do VPNs affect online casino play in China?

Players in China commonly use VPNs (Virtual Private Networks) to bypass the Great Firewall and access offshore online casinos. While essential for access, a stable and reliable VPN connection is crucial to ensure smooth gameplay and prevent disconnections.

Are there specific software providers popular in China?

Yes, software providers like Evolution Gaming, Pragmatic Play, Asia Gaming (AG Gaming), Playtech, and SA Gaming are highly popular in China. They are known for their high-quality live casino offerings (especially Baccarat and Sic Bo) and a wide range of engaging slot machines, including many with Asian themes.
